MDVIP Overview

MDVIP: Transforming Primary Care, One Patient at a Time

MDVIP is a national leader in personalized healthcare, empowering over 425,000 members to achieve their health and wellness goals through a network of more than 1,400 concierge primary care physicians. Our program emphasizes preventive medicine, offering comprehensive screenings, advanced diagnostics, and individualized wellness plans. Recognized as a Great Place to Work® since 2018, MDVIP is committed to excellence in patient care and employee satisfaction. 

Position Summary

As a Success Manager, you will be responsible for building strong relationships with physicians and Practice

Management, driving business outcomes, and ensuring their success with our solutions. You will leverage your

medical knowledge and sales expertise to develop tailored strategies that enhance productivity, increase

membership, and improve overall Practice performance. Your success will be measured based on membership

and revenue growth, member retention, and practice performance.
